Abstract

The invention discloses a track operation vehicle power transmission method. A track operation vehicle comprises a power vehicle and an operation vehicle. The method comprises the following steps: A)setting an overall power supply system, a high-speed walking system and a low-speed walking power source on the power vehicle, setting a low-constant speed walking system on the operation vehicle, andsetting an operation system on the operation vehicle independently or on the power vehicle and the operation vehicle; B) supplying power to the operation system from the overall power supply system,selectively supplying power to the high-speed walking system and the low-speed walking power source, and providing an electric transmission traction system for the high-speed walking system; C) providing a hydraulic power source for the low-constant speed walking system from the low-speed walking power source, and providing an electric transmission static hydraulic transmission traction system forthe low-constant speed walking system. By adopting the method, the technical problem of power transmission of a double-power source tract operation vehicle in high-speed walking and low-speed walkingmodes can be solved, and requirements on walking speeds and control precision under different working conditions can be met.

Description

technical field [0001] The invention relates to the technical field of railway engineering machinery, in particular to a power transmission method for a rail work vehicle driven by dual power sources. Background technique [0002] As a widely used rail operating vehicle, the rail milling and grinding vehicle is a rail engineering maintenance vehicle used to repair rail surface defects. The rail milling and grinding vehicle processes the surface of the rail through the milling unit and the grinding unit installed on the vehicle chassis, so that the parameters such as the roughness, wave grinding and profile of the rail surface reach the required value. The cutter on the milling unit mills the surface of the rail to eliminate damage and corrugation on the surface of the rail to control the cross-sectional profile.
